MN 7th District Congressional Art Competition Winners
(Washington, D.C.) 7th District U.S. Congresswoman Michelle Fischbach’s office once again participated in the Congressional Art Competition and this year’s winners have been announced.
The office received over 40 submissions from students across the 7th District.
First Place went to “Geese in Harmony” by Kira Gurley from Redwood Valley High School and will hang in the U.S. Capitol.
Second Place: “Trout” by Griffin DeGroot from Central Minnesota Christian School will be displayed in Congresswoman Fischbach’s office in Washington, D.C.
Honorable Mention: “Emerald Jade Green” by Kerstyn Lindsey from Ada-Borup-West High School will be displayed in the Congresswoman’s district office.
Honorable Mention: “Left Behind” by Margo Klassen from Community Christian School will be displayed in the Congresswoman’s district office.
